Longview, Washington experiences frequent heavy rainfall and occasional atmospheric river events, increasing the risk of flooding. The region's hilly terrain can lead to hillside water intrusion, particularly in areas like Beacon Hill and Longview Heights. Longview's moderate humidity levels create an environment where mold can quickly develop after water damage. The combination of high moisture and warm temperatures allows mold spores to spread rapidly, especially in wood-frame homes.
